Circuitos digitales

Solo disponible en BuenasTareas
  • Páginas : 7 (1704 palabras )
  • Descarga(s) : 0
  • Publicado : 24 de noviembre de 2011
Leer documento completo
Vista previa del texto
Capítulo

Circuitos secuenciales básicos

Circuitos secuenciales básicos
Introducción
Con este capítulo comenzamos una andadura importante en este mundillo de los sistemas binarios ya que aprenderemos un concepto nuevo: la memorización de un bit. Cuando en las prácticas montes el circuito comprobarás la sencillez de su funcionamiento. En este momento estás capacitado para solucionarcualquier sistema en el que el nivel lógico de las salidas dependa exclusivamente de los estados de las entradas. Dicho de otra manera: la salida es función de la combinación de entradas. Pero con las herramientas que hemos aprendido a usar en el desarrollo de circuitos combinacionales no podemos construir circuitos cuya salida sea distinta para combinaciones de entradas iguales.

Contenido
6.8.Implementación de circuitos biestables 6.9. Transformación de biestables
6.9.1. Construir un biestable tipo D a partir de un R-S 6.9.2. Construir un biestable tipo T a partir de uno D

Objetivos
Cuando completes este capítulo pretendemos: u Que descubras un circuito que cumple una importante misión en la lógica digital: el biestable, como memoria de un bit. u Que conozcas el proceso mediante elcual se fue perfeccionando. u Que distingas los distintos tipos de biestables y sus características. u En la parte práctica los ejercicios a realizar te confirmarán los resultados previstos y te permitirán manejar los chips típicos secuenciales y hacer experiencias interesantes. u Manejando circuitos integrados comerciales serás capaz de construir y controlar el funcionamiento de FlipFlop D y JK. uDisfrutarás jugando con los circuitos de entretenimiento que te proponemos como el juego del más rápido y una alarma por rotura de hilo.

6.10. Análisis de circuitos secuenciales
6.10.1. Análisis mediante los cronogramas 6.10.2. Análisis mediante diagramas de estados

Circuitos secuenciales básicos

6.8 Implementación de circuitos biestables
Vamos a investigar un poco sobre la manera deimplementar los biestables. Es decir, cómo disponemos el cableado de las puertas para conseguir el tipo de biestable deseado. A esta señal de control o sincronismo se la llama reloj y su intervención hace que ahora el circuito sea un biestable síncrono.

Circuito lógico
Biestable R-S síncrono

Símbolo

Circuito lógico y símbolo de un R-S síncrono con prefijación asíncrona

Para ello elfabricante interpone un circuito electrónico para transformar un pulso por nivel en un pulso por flanco, como te mostramos a continuación.

Circuito lógico y símbolo de un biestable R-S síncrono por flanco de subida

2

Circuitos secuenciales básicos
Veamos ahora cómo nos quedará un biestable J-K con señal de reloj.

Circuito lógico del biestable J-K con su símbolo

En la figura siguientevemos el circuito lógico de un biestable J-K maestro-esclavo. Será una buena práctica para ti investigar el funcionamiento de este circuito para verificar si es correcto. (Te sugerimos colocar sobre el esquema una hoja transparente a fin de ir apuntando con lápiz niveles 0 y 1 en la entrada, y ver su repercusión en la salida.)

Circuito lógico de un biestable J-K maestro-esclavo

Un biestabletipo D, lo obtenemos de la siguiente manera:

Ck 0 1 1

D X 0 1

Qn+1 Qn 0 1

Diagrama lógico y símbolo del biestable tipo D

Un biestable tipo T, lo obtenemos de la siguiente manera:

Ck 0 1 1

T X 0 1

Qn+1 Qn Qn ------Qn

Circuito lógico y símbolo de un biestable tipo T

3

Circuitos secuenciales básicos

Ejercicio Propuesto
1. Reescribe la Tabla de Verdad delbiestable R-S cuando éste utiliza puertas NOR en lugar de las NAND. 2. Reescribe la Tabla de Verdad para el circuito resultante de haber quitado las puertas NOT tanto para cuando utilizas NAND como para cuando usas NOR.

Generación del flanco de un pulso
Analizaremos ahora la generación del flanco del pulso de reloj. Para ello observa la figura que te mostramos a continuación, donde vemos el tema...
tracking img